mm. Anti-Money Laundering Laws. The operations of the Company and the Subsidiaries are and have been conducted at all times in compliance with applicable financial recordkeeping and reporting requirements, including those of the Bank Secrecy Act, as amended by Title III of the Uniting and Strengthening America by Providing Appropriate Tools Required to Intercept and Obstruct Terrorism Act of 2001 (USA PATRIOT Act), as amended, the applicable anti-money laundering statutes of all jurisdictions where the Company and the Subsidiaries conduct business, the rules and regulations thereunder and any related or similar rules, regulations and guidelines issued, administered or enforced by any governmental agency (collectively, the “Anti-Money Laundering Laws”) and no action, suit or proceeding by or before any court or governmental agency, authority or body or any arbitrator involving the Company or any Subsidiary with respect to the Anti-Money Laundering Laws is pending or, to the knowledge of the Company, threatened.
nn. OFAC. None of the Company, any Subsidiary nor, to the knowledge of the Company, any director, officer, agent, employee, affiliate or representative of the Company or any Subsidiary is currently the subject or the target of any sanctions administered or enforced by the U.S. Government (including, without limitation, sanctions administered or enforced by the Office of Foreign Assets Control of the U.S. Department of the Treasury or the U.S. Department of State), the United Nations Security Council, the European Union, the United Kingdom (including, without limitation, sanctions administered or enforced by Her Majesty’s Treasury) or other relevant sanctions authority in any jurisdiction in which the Company and the Subsidiaries conduct business (collectively “Sanctions”), nor is the Company or any Subsidiary organized or resident in a country or territory that is the subject or target of Sanctions (including, without limitation, Crimea, Cuba, Iran, North Korea and Syria).
oo. Related Party Transactions. There are no business relationships or related party transactions involving the Company or any Subsidiary or, to the knowledge of the Company, any other person that are required to be described in the Registration Statement and the Prospectus that have not been described as required.
pp. Status Under the Securities Act. The Company was not and is not an “ineligible issuer” as defined in Rule 405 under the Securities Act at the times specified in Rules 164 and 433 under the Securities Act in connection with the offering of the Placement Shares.
